Excel Sheet Pdf Macro
Vba macros save time as they automate repetitive tasks. This section contains the base code to save excel as pdf from different objects (workbooks, worksheets, ranges and charts).
101 Ready To Use Excel Macros EBook (10 OFF) Excel
Hi i recently used the following macro, provided by gary's student, to create a pdf from an active sheet, generate a unique filename based on a cell ref and save it to a specific location.
Excel sheet pdf macro. See the section further down, for details on how the macro works. Our first and perhaps most widely used pdf conversion is from pdf to excel. Select the macro from the list.
The sample save_excel_as_pdf_1 macro above used the worksheet.exportasfixedformat method with its only required parameter (type). What is an excel macro? I want user to view/save the data in pdf file automaticallu upon clicking command button.
If you have any questions or problems saving multiple excel sheets to a pdf leave a comment below. Here's a vba macro that'll save you a ton of time by letting you print up all the embedded charts that are in a workbook in one shot. The data structure i prepared for this example is very simple, a defined table with employees information in one sheet, and in another sheet.
Hi i have data in my spread sheet, assume sheet1. In this same sheet, i have created a macro that allows me to send this sheet as a pdf but i would like for the pdf file name to change in accordance with the name chosen from the drop down list. This macro works well for me, however, i would like to add to it so that i can also attach it too and email and send to a specific email group (using outlook).
Save active sheet as pdf. Dear readers, in my previous article, you saw how to save an excel sheet as pdf file.now you know, how to save an excel sheet as a pdf. C:pdfexport.pdf is the path and name of your saving pdf file.
To make things easier, i italicized the spots where i would customize it for my purposes. This receipt covers the range a2:l21. Then turn off the design mode under the developer tab.
That i got a single pdf file with both sheets. Excel vba macro to email sheet as pdf attachment. Viewing/saving any onething will work for me.
Here are the steps to create the macro button: Below is a simple vba macro that will allow you to quickly turn your selected worksheet(s) into a pdf file in a snap. For example, we could have a macro that tells excel to take a number, add two, multiply by five, and return the modulus.
Extract the xml structure of the pdf form; When i tried the active sheet(s) option, i got what i wanted. To use this code you need to select the cell from where you want to start the serial numbers and when you run this it shows you a message box where you need to enter the highest number for the serial.
Prepare the excel structure for export. I have a macro to export certain sheets in a workbook to separate pdf's (for reporting purposes). The following code saves the selected sheets as a single pdf.
If you need to make modifications, hopefully, you will be able to follow along with Investintech is a company devoted to creating industry leading pdf converter software. Lets start with excel, as its probably the most familiar step for you.
It works properly for me in one workbook, however, in a different workbook it is exporting all sheets. In the code, commandbutton1 is the command button name you will use to save active sheet as pdf file. I tried manually saving these two pages using selection in the options dialog to save the two sheets i had selected, but got blank pages.
From a vba perspective, it is the exportasfilxedformat method combined with the type property set to xltypepdf that creates a pdf. 1) i've created this worksheet as a template and that entire sheet will then be copy/pasted into another workbook and saved. From excel, go to file> save as> pdf> workbook.
Export active sheet as pdf file. Print a certain range as pdf and send as attachment with a choice of a body. The code is written to save your document in the same folder as the excel file currently resides.
Now you know, how to save an excel sheet as a pdf. There are many scenarios when you may want to save an excel document as a pdf file instead of a spreadsheet. I can't figure out where i am going wrong.
It also makes it easier to view your excel sheet(s) on a mobile device. However, as i explain further above, the exportasfixedformat method has 9 parameters that allow you to further specify how visual basic for applications carries out the conversion from excel to pdf. Map the xml file to an excel sheet.
It is a piece of programming code that runs in an excel environment but you dont need to be a coder to program macros. There are two additional macros below: The new convert excel to pdf feature is a nice way to share an excel sheet (or multiple sheets) without giving someone access to the entire file.
Also, we have seen how to send the activesheet as an attachment in email.in this article i am going to show you how to send the activesheet as an attachment in pdf format. When i recorded this as a macro, excel used activesheet when it successfully published the pdf. This macro code will help you to automatically add serial numbers in your excel sheet which can be helpful for you if you work with large data.
Openafterpublish:=false pdfname = activesheet.range(t1) chdir c: emp 'this is where youo set a defult file path. Excel macro is a record and playback tool that simply records your excel steps and the macro will play it back as many times as you want. Copy the code to a regular code module, then select the sheet(s) you want to export, and run the macro.
_ & vbcrlf & vbcrlf & press ok to exit this macro., vbcritical, unable to delete file exit sub end if end if set xusedrng = xsht.usedrange if application.worksheetfunction.counta(xusedrng.cells) <> 0 then 'save as pdf file xsht.exportasfixedformat type:=xltypepdf, filename:=xfolder, quality:=xlqualitystandard 'create outlook email set. For example, if you wish to send out only a specific portion of a larger sheet, or you dont want it to be editable. Gan, bisa bantu, contoh begini saya punya 6 sheet pada 1 file excel (sheet1, sheet2, sheet3, sheet4,sheet5 dan sheet6), saya ingin membuat 1 tombol macro yang sekaligus mengcopy 3 sheet yang saya perlukan saja menjadi 1 file baru yang di dalam filenya terdapat sheet2, sheet5 dan sheet6 dengan copy paste value,, gimana gan.
Start date feb 25, 2019; Tags attachment body choice pdf send y. assuming that you have excel 2007 or later:
If this is cropping the excel sheet into multiple pdf pages, select all cells on the first sheet and go to file> print area> set print area, this should give you a pdf of the entire sheet. Umumnya orang belum mengetahui cara ini, mereka hanya bisa menyimpan 1 halaman file excel saja. Joined feb 5, 2019 messages 37.
To save on this excel range as pdf, we will use the above mentioned generic vba code of exporting excel sheet to pdf. The drop down list is on cell c4i dont need to save a copy of it, i just want the pdf file name to read the information on cell c4. Menyimpan file excel ke dalam file pdf memudahkan kita dalam mengirim dan mencetak file agar ukurannya pas dengan kertas yang digunakan.
Feb 25, 2019 #1 i want to do as the title states. Press alt+f11 to activate the visual basic editor. Here, i have designed this receipt format.
When i do this and press my 'save to pdf' button, the sheet tries to pull and run the macro from the template workbook and then subsequently saves the pdf in the file where the template workbook resides. The following macro code will export the active sheet (or sheets) in pdf format. I have already set the print area.
Press the alt + q keys simultaneously to close the microsoft visual basic for applications window. I want to print/save/export it as a pdf using the button create pdf. Cara berikut ini dapat anda lakukan di mircosoft office 2007, 2010, dan 2013.
101 Ready To Use Excel Macros EBook Excel macros, Excel
Ruby cheatsheet Cheat Sheets Pinterest
cogniviewexcelcheatsheet.png (11901684) Excel tips
Excel 2007 Quick Reference Card
Open PDF File Using Excel VBA Excel, Coding, Pdf
101 Ready To Use Excel Macros EBook (10 OFF) (With
The Ultimate Excel Cheatsheet Socialphy (for excel
101 Ready To Use Excel Macros EBook Excel macros, Excel
Basic Excel Formulas Cheat Sheet Excel Cheat Sheet
Access 101 Ready To Use Macros with VBA Code which your
Top 100 Useful Excel MACRO CODES Examples [VBA Library
Microsoft Excel 2016 Quick Reference Guide Microsoft
Free Excel 2011 Quick Referenc Card. http//www
101 Ready To Use Excel Macros EBook (10 OFF) in 2020
Excel 2016 Quick Reference Card. http//www.customguide